Transaction 8d156492ec128a4c95a9b1b59e0348b1b1382cec39617300a70977ea5d3cc645
1 Input
1 Output
-
8d156492ec128a4c95a9b1b59e0348b1b1382cec39617300a70977ea5d3cc645:0
- value
- 255507
- script pubkey
- OP_0 OP_PUSHBYTES_20 52d440b065727a62396386dfe4e950895ad57444
- address
- bc1q2t2ypvr9wfaxywtrsm07f62s39dd2azyfr8jra